In Virginia Beach,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+, heavily influenced by the scope and materials. Key cost factors include the linear footage of cabinets, the complexity of the layout (e.g., custom angles for a beach house), and whether you choose stock, semi-custom, or fully custom units. Local labor rates and potential costs for complying with Virginia's building codes, especially in flood zones (AE zones) near the water, can also affect the final price.
A standard installation for an average kitchen typically takes 2 to 5 days of on-site work, not including the lead time for cabinet fabrication and delivery. In Virginia Beach, it's wise to schedule during drier months (late spring or early fall) to mitigate the high humidity and occasional tropical storm threats in summer, which can affect material delivery and the stability of wood during installation. Winter is generally feasible but may be subject to contractor availability.
For a simple cabinet replacement where the layout and plumbing/electrical are unchanged, a permit is usually not required in Virginia Beach. However, if your renovation involves moving walls, plumbing, or electrical outlets, you will likely need a permit from the Virginia Beach Department of Housing and Neighborhood Preservation. This is crucial for ensuring compliance with state and local codes, especially in older homes or properties in coastal flood plains.

The high humidity and salt air in Virginia Beach can cause wood to swell and contract, and can accelerate corrosion on hardware. We recommend choosing moisture-resistant materials like marine-grade plywood boxes, finishes with excellent moisture barriers, and stainless steel or coated hardware. Proper installation techniques, including adequate sealing and allowing materials to acclimate to your home's interior humidity for several days before installation, are critical for long-term durability.
